The Universal Audio Volt 2 Recording Studio Pack pairs UA’s 2-in/2-out desktop unit with a matched condenser mic, headphones, and software so first takes sound finished instead of fragile. At the center is the Volt 2, delivering 24-bit/192 kHz conversion, two front-panel XLR combo preamps with 48 V phantom power, and UA’s switchable Vintage mic mode that echoes the 610 tube preamp’s harmonic contour. Input 1 and 2 each add instrument sensitivity for direct guitar/bass, so you can track DI and mic simultaneously without adapters.

Dynamics control is handled in the DAW or via plug-ins here, keeping the front end clean and predictable. Monitoring stays straightforward. Hardware direct monitoring blends live input with DAW return for near-zero-latency cue mixes, which means singers and podcasters hear themselves in time with no distracting slapback. The large Monitor and Phones knobs are easy to grab, and per-channel gain with LED metering keeps headroom honest.

The included large-diaphragm condenser mic and XLR cable plug into input 1 and work well for vocals, acoustic instruments, and room capture. Closed-back headphones in the box seal out click bleed on overdubs and present a reliable reference for edits and comping. Around the back, MIDI In/Out supports keyboards and drum machines without an extra dongle, and balanced line outputs feed your powered monitors or outboard chain. USB-C provides bus power for mobile rigs; optional external power is there when peripherals demand it.

Day to day, the value shows up in repeatability. Leave Vintage off for a transparent path that takes plug-ins well, or enable it when you want a touch of forward midrange and smoother transients. The compact, metal chassis with wood side cheeks survives backpacks and small desks gracefully. If the brief is plug in, set gain, and capture, the Volt 2 Recording Studio Pack gets you from blank session to keeper take with minimal setup and zero drama.
